WebShwmae Su'mae Day began back in 2013 and is celebrated on the 15th of October every year. Shwmae Su'mae day is a celebration of the Welsh language and raises awareness in the wider community. It encourages Welsh learners to 'give it a go' - 'Rhowch gynnig arni' whatever their level of ability.
